| package org.apache.beam.sdk.extensions.sql.impl.udf; |
| |
| import com.google.auto.service.AutoService; |
| import org.apache.beam.sdk.schemas.Schema; |
| |
| /** TrigonometricFunctions. */ |
| @AutoService(BeamBuiltinFunctionProvider.class) |
| @SuppressWarnings({ |
| "nullness" // TODO(https://github.com/apache/beam/issues/20497) |
| }) |
| public class BuiltinTrigonometricFunctions extends BeamBuiltinFunctionProvider { |
| |
| /** |
| * COSH(X) |
| * |
| * <p>Computes the hyperbolic cosine of X. Generates an error if an overflow occurs. |
| */ |
| // TODO: handle overflow |
| @UDF( |
| funcName = "COSH", |
| parameterArray = {Schema.TypeName.DOUBLE}, |
| returnType = Schema.TypeName.DOUBLE) |
| public Double cosh(Double o) { |
| if (o == null) { |
| return null; |
| } |
| return Math.cosh(o); |
| } |
| |
| /** |
| * SINH(X) |
| * |
| * <p>Computes the hyperbolic sine of X. Generates an error if an overflow occurs. |
| */ |
| // TODO: handle overflow |
| @UDF( |
| funcName = "SINH", |
| parameterArray = {Schema.TypeName.DOUBLE}, |
| returnType = Schema.TypeName.DOUBLE) |
| public Double sinh(Double o) { |
| if (o == null) { |
| return null; |
| } |
| return Math.sinh(o); |
| } |
| |
| /** |
| * TANH(X) |
| * |
| * <p>Computes hyperbolic tangent of X. Does not fail. |
| */ |
| @UDF( |
| funcName = "TANH", |
| parameterArray = {Schema.TypeName.DOUBLE}, |
| returnType = Schema.TypeName.DOUBLE) |
| public Double tanh(Double o) { |
| if (o == null) { |
| return null; |
| } |
| return Math.tanh(o); |
| } |
| } |
